    Had the same issue on the first couple of pulls. We just rotated the entire fight 45 degrees. So we'd pull Horridon to the 2nd door once the first door opened and had people stack halfway between them (pulled him to the third for phase 2, etc). All the adds came from the same side relative to the raid and made a beeline for the healers behind me, so I just intercepted their path. The Dinomancer spawned right on top of us every time for quick easy deeps, and adds never ran rampant.

    So much easier with everything coming from the same direction.

    Depends highly on the encounters, loads of melee hits that can be blocked -> Shield Block (super high vengeance examples excluded like Empress Heroic where you're @ 500K Vengeance and get Barriers for over 1 million).

    Dots & unblockable (magic or otherwise) damage -> Barrier

  13. #653
    Deleted
    It also dictates your "healiness", if you hit shield block you won't be hitted for the next 6 seconds, you either avoid (100% damage reduction) or block (30% damage reduction on a block, 60% on a critical block) the next few attacks. With shield barrier you'll probably absorb the next hitting attack but no attacks after that. The big advantage of shield barrier = it works on everything, magical abilities and attacks that aren't designed for blocking (eg = Horridon's Triple Puncture).

    Some things to consider:
    1) if you use shield block frequently you can glyph for it, noticeable (+50%) increasing your main ability shield slam.
    2) if you critical block you procc enrage, increasing your damage dealt (+10% for 6s) and it nets you 10 rage which also helps with maintaining your active mitigation.
    3) You can use shield barrier 'anytime', you almost always have 20 rage to spare while it's a tougher task to get to 60 rage for shield block from time to time. Shield barriers absorb scaling is linear, so there's no downside in using a 20 rage absorb shield *now* and working on a bigger shield after it's away.

    I regulary use shield block to improve my damage dealt and use shield barrier on predictable bursts.

    Ps: 500k vengeance = <500k absorb after the 5.2 nerfs. And block reduces damage percentage based so it's not weak at higher damage numbers, it's just different to heal.
    PPs: if you already have another warrior tanking with you consider a reroll, bringing the same tanking class twice compared to having different toolsets/raidcooldowns is like night and day.

    Barriers don't stack and cant overwrite each other if you try to recast and it has a lower value than the first

    The thing that will keep you alive most is block, work on getting that to maximum uptime and using barrier on unblockable damage
